Australian Dollar (AUD) Overview

The Australian Dollar, also known as the Aussie, is the official currency of Australia, including Christmas Island, Cocos (Keeling) Islands, and Norfolk Island. It is subdivided into 100 cents.

Nigerian Naira (NGN) Overview

The Nigerian Naira is the official currency of Nigeria. It is subdivided into 100 kobo.

Why is the AUD to NGN Exchange Rate Important?

The exchange rate between the Australian Dollar and Nigerian Naira is important for several reasons:

  • International Trade: The AUD to NGN exchange rate affects the cost of importing goods from Australia to Nigeria and vice versa.
  • Tourism: Nigerians traveling to Australia and Australians visiting Nigeria need to exchange their currencies, making the exchange rate a crucial factor in their travel plans.
  • Investment: Investors interested in investing in either the Australian or Nigerian markets need to consider the exchange rate when converting their funds.

Factors Affecting the AUD to NGN Exchange Rate

Several factors can influence the AUD to NGN exchange rate, including:

  • Inflation Rate: Changes in the inflation rate in both Australia and Nigeria can impact the exchange rate.
  • Interest Rates: Interest rate changes in both countries can affect the exchange rate.
  • Economic Indicators: Economic indicators such as GDP growth, unemployment rate, and trade balance can influence the exchange rate.
  • Political Stability: Political stability or instability in both countries can impact the exchange rate.
